The Aged Care Quality and Safety Commission provides e-learning modules for Aged Care Workers, self-service resources for educators, and live learning.
The Commission's online learning system is called Alis, short for Aged Care Learning Information Solution.

CHSP Providers and their workers can access the e-modules at no cost via the Commission's online learning platform. Providers can also register to host the modules on their own Learning Management System. This is a great way to embed modules into your existing training structure.
The Commission also provides self-service information and talking points for Educators, on the Strengthened Aged Care Quality Standards, Code of Conduct, Visitor supports, Case-based education, SIRS and Food and nutrition.
Workers can also access live learning sessions at a cost. Current workshops include Effective Incident Management Systems (IMS), and The strengthened Quality Standards: Preparing for the changes.
You can also access the Commission's resource library, filtering by audience, topic, type of resource, year or language.
